From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 30796 invoked by alias); 20 Jun 2003 06:22:02 -0000 Mailing-List: contact gdb-patches-help@sources.redhat.com; run by ezmlm Precedence: bulk List-Subscribe: List-Archive: List-Post: List-Help: , Sender: gdb-patches-owner@sources.redhat.com Received: (qmail 28215 invoked from network); 20 Jun 2003 06:20:49 -0000 Received: from unknown (HELO planck.amplepower.com) (216.39.162.139) by sources.redhat.com with SMTP; 20 Jun 2003 06:20:49 -0000 Received: from [192.168.8.29] (helo=bozoland.mynet) by planck.amplepower.com with esmtp (Exim 3.36 #1 (Debian)) id 19TF4U-0007bF-00 for ; Thu, 19 Jun 2003 23:08:27 -0700 Date: Fri, 20 Jun 2003 06:22:00 -0000 From: "Theodore A. Roth" X-X-Sender: troth@bozoland.mynet To: gdb-patches@sources.redhat.com Subject: [RFC:avr] use regcache instead of read_register Message-ID: MIME-Version: 1.0 Content-Type: MULTIPART/MIXED; BOUNDARY="-1463809535-2044076420-1056089903=:3963" X-SW-Source: 2003-06/txt/msg00648.txt.bz2 This message is in MIME format. The first part should be readable text, while the remaining parts are likely unreadable without MIME-aware tools. Send mail to mime@docserver.cac.washington.edu for more info. ---1463809535-2044076420-1056089903=:3963 Content-Type: TEXT/PLAIN; charset=US-ASCII Content-length: 487 Hi, The ARI caught this and it seems like a trivial change. There is a bit of confusion though in the use of current_regcache since the ARI says this: current regcache 57 Replace current_regcache with explict parameter What would that explicit parameter be? If this patch is ok, it brings the ARI count for the AVR down to 0. Ted Roth 2003-06-19 Theodore A. Roth * avr-tdep.c (avr_read_pc): Use regcache instead of read_register. (avr_read_sp): Ditto. ---1463809535-2044076420-1056089903=:3963 Content-Type: TEXT/PLAIN; charset=US-ASCII; name="avr-use-regcache.diff" Content-Transfer-Encoding: BASE64 Content-ID: Content-Description: Content-Disposition: attachment; filename="avr-use-regcache.diff" Content-length: 1485 MjAwMy0wNi0xOSAgVGhlb2RvcmUgQS4gUm90aCAgPHRyb3RoQG9wZW5hdnIu b3JnPg0KDQoJKiBhdnItdGRlcC5jIChhdnJfcmVhZF9wYyk6IFVzZSByZWdj YWNoZSBpbnN0ZWFkIG9mIHJlYWRfcmVnaXN0ZXIuDQoJKGF2cl9yZWFkX3Nw KTogRGl0dG8uDQoNCkluZGV4OiBhdnItdGRlcC5jDQo9PT09PT09PT09PT09 P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09 PT09PT09PT09DQpSQ1MgZmlsZTogL2N2cy9zcmMvc3JjL2dkYi9hdnItdGRl cC5jLHYNCnJldHJpZXZpbmcgcmV2aXNpb24gMS42NA0KZGlmZiAtdSAtcjEu NjQgYXZyLXRkZXAuYw0KLS0tIGF2ci10ZGVwLmMJMjAgSnVuIDIwMDMgMDU6 NTM6NDIgLTAwMDAJMS42NA0KKysrIGF2ci10ZGVwLmMJMjAgSnVuIDIwMDMg MDY6MDk6MjcgLTAwMDANCkBAIC0zMjQsMTIgKzMyNCwxMiBAQA0KIGF2cl9y ZWFkX3BjIChwdGlkX3QgcHRpZCkNCiB7DQogICBwdGlkX3Qgc2F2ZV9wdGlk Ow0KLSAgQ09SRV9BRERSIHBjOw0KKyAgVUxPTkdFU1QgcGM7DQogICBDT1JF X0FERFIgcmV0dmFsOw0KIA0KICAgc2F2ZV9wdGlkID0gaW5mZXJpb3JfcHRp ZDsNCiAgIGluZmVyaW9yX3B0aWQgPSBwdGlkOw0KLSAgcGMgPSAoaW50KSBy ZWFkX3JlZ2lzdGVyIChBVlJfUENfUkVHTlVNKTsNCisgIHJlZ2NhY2hlX2Nv b2tlZF9yZWFkX3Vuc2lnbmVkIChjdXJyZW50X3JlZ2NhY2hlLCBBVlJfUENf UkVHTlVNLCAmcGMpOw0KICAgaW5mZXJpb3JfcHRpZCA9IHNhdmVfcHRpZDsN CiAgIHJldHZhbCA9IGF2cl9tYWtlX2lhZGRyIChwYyk7DQogICByZXR1cm4g cmV0dmFsOw0KQEAgLTM0OSw3ICszNDksMTAgQEANCiBzdGF0aWMgQ09SRV9B RERSDQogYXZyX3JlYWRfc3AgKHZvaWQpDQogew0KLSAgcmV0dXJuIChhdnJf bWFrZV9zYWRkciAocmVhZF9yZWdpc3RlciAoQVZSX1NQX1JFR05VTSkpKTsN CisgIFVMT05HRVNUIHNwOw0KKw0KKyAgcmVnY2FjaGVfY29va2VkX3JlYWRf dW5zaWduZWQgKGN1cnJlbnRfcmVnY2FjaGUsIEFWUl9TUF9SRUdOVU0sICZz cCk7DQorICByZXR1cm4gKGF2cl9tYWtlX3NhZGRyIChzcCkpOw0KIH0NCiAN CiBzdGF0aWMgaW50DQo= ---1463809535-2044076420-1056089903=:3963--